Bethune-Cookman College
is a
historically black college
in
Daytona Beach, Florida
. Dr.
Mary McLeod Bethune
, a graduate of
Barber-Scotia College
when it was still Scotia Seminary, founded the Daytona Educational and Industrial Training School for Negro Girls in
1904
. In
1923
, it merged with the Cookman Institute of
Jacksonville, Florida
and became a co-ed high school. A year later in
1924
, it became affiliated with the
Methodist church
. By
1931
, it had become a junior college, and took on its present name of Bethune-Cookman College.
